find the quadratic equation whose roots are "-2" and 7

Respuesta :

loneguy
loneguy loneguy
  • 10-06-2022

Answer:

[tex]x^2 -5x-14=0[/tex]

Step-by-step explanation:

[tex]\text{Given that, the roots are}~ \alpha = -2~ \text{and}~ \beta = 7.\\\\\text{The quadratic equation with roots}~ \alpha~ \text{and}~ \beta ~ \text{is,} \\\\~~~~~~~x^2 - \left(\alpha + \beta \right)x + \alpha \beta =0 \\\\\implies x^2 -(-2+7)x + (-2)(7) = 0\\\\\implies x^2 -5x-14=0[/tex]
